Characteristics:

Carrier resins, often referred to as matrix resins or binder resins, are a class of polymers used as the main structural component in various composite materials. They possess several key characteristics:

  1. Binder Function: Carrier resins serve as a binding material that holds together and encapsulates the reinforcement materials, such as fibers or particles, in composite structures.

  2. Thermosetting Properties: These resins are typically thermosetting, meaning they undergo a chemical transformation upon curing, which results in a hardened and rigid structure. This property enhances the overall strength of the composite.

  3. Compatibility: Carrier resins are formulated to be compatible with the specific reinforcement materials they are intended to bond, ensuring good adhesion and a uniform distribution of the reinforcements.

  4. Chemical and Environmental Resistance: They often exhibit resistance to a wide range of chemicals and environmental factors, making them suitable for various applications where exposure to harsh conditions is expected.

  5. Customizable Formulations: Manufacturers can tailor the formulation of carrier resins to meet the specific requirements of a composite, adjusting characteristics such as curing time, mechanical properties, and chemical resistance.

Advantages:

  1. Enhanced Strength: Carrier resins form a solid matrix that reinforces the structural integrity of composite materials, providing enhanced strength and load-bearing capacity.

  2. Uniform Distribution: These resins ensure an even distribution of the reinforcement materials, reducing the risk of weak spots or inconsistencies within the composite.

  3. Customization: Manufacturers have the flexibility to customize carrier resins to achieve desired material properties, making them versatile for a wide range of applications.

  4. Durability: Composite materials using carrier resins tend to be durable, as the resin matrix provides protection to the embedded reinforcements, shielding them from environmental factors and physical wear.

  5. Chemical Resistance: Carrier resins often exhibit resistance to chemicals and solvents, adding to the durability and longevity of composite products.

Application Scenarios:

  1. Aerospace Industry: Carrier resins are used in the production of aerospace composites, such as carbon fiber-reinforced materials for aircraft components. These composites offer high strength-to-weight ratios.

  2. Automotive Industry: Composite materials with carrier resins are employed in automotive components, including body panels and interior parts. These materials reduce weight while maintaining structural integrity.

  3. Wind Energy: Composite blades for wind turbines often utilize carrier resins to bond and protect the fiberglass or carbon fiber reinforcements, ensuring the durability and longevity of the blades.

  4. Construction: In the construction sector, carrier resins are used in the production of reinforced concrete and composites for applications like bridges and infrastructure components, enhancing structural strength and longevity.

  5. Marine Industry: Boat hulls and components are constructed using carrier resins to create lightweight and durable composite structures that can withstand the harsh marine environment.

  6. Electronics: Carrier resins are used in printed circuit boards (PCBs) as a binder material to hold together the layers of copper traces and insulating materials. They offer good dielectric properties and heat resistance.

  7. Sporting Goods: In sports equipment like tennis rackets, golf club shafts, and bicycles, carrier resins are employed to create lightweight, high-performance composites.

In summary, carrier resins play a critical role in the creation of composite materials, offering strength, customization, and durability. Their applications span various industries where lightweight, strong, and durable materials are essential.
